Handover Note — from Director T. Vask to Director L. Omrey

Lena, quick rundown for finance: the Pellgrave term sheet is in the shared drawer, marked draft three. Their royalty ask is steep, but the exclusivity window is negotiable. I'd push back on the milestone payments before anything else. Keep the modelling tight. Everything hinges on what's outlined in the confidential note below.

confidential, kagep-kahof: Druokax Systems plans to lower the Ulaath list price by 53 percent in March.

Finance Review Summary — Customer Concentration, Verelux Group

Revenue concentration remains elevated: the Dunmoor account represents 31% of recurring income, up from 26% last year. Two further accounts together add 18%. Contract renewal timing clusters in the second quarter, compounding exposure. Heads of department should factor this into hiring and inventory commitments. Mitigation options are under review, and the confidential note below sets out the plan.

internal memo for faweg-hahip: Silokix Works plans to lower the Tamvan list price by 8 percent in June.

Ticket: Staging env misconfigured for Siftgate bloom filter

The bloom layer in front of the Pellet KV store is rejecting all lookups in staging because the env file was copied from the dev template without credentials. False-positive tuning values are fine; only the auth line is missing. To unblock the weekly demo, the Pellet admission secret must be set on the following line.

env line for yaguf-fajop: LEDGER_TOKEN13=fb08984397349

## Bramblewick Environments

Quick notes for support folks: Bramblewick runs behind the Copperline load balancer in staging and prod. Health checks hit the shallow endpoint only, so a green check doesn't mean the database is happy — check the deep probe if tickets mention timeouts. The health check settings for each environment are as follows.

settings of tagef-bawif:
DRUIX_HOST=druix.zemvarlabs.internal
DRUIX_PORT=8000